Description Details of Position This is a Full-Time position Location: San Lorenzo, CA Job Schedule: Sunday- Thursday 3:00 AM- 11:30 AM Starting Pay : $$ per hour DOE The position is immediately available Position Summary: Handy Man Needed Maintenance Tech is responsible for the day-to-day troubleshooting, maintenance, and repairs of all commercial equipment and machinery within the chilled food facility. Keeps the culinary center and its grounds in a safe, clean, secure, and operable condition. The primary objective is to keep operations running efficiently and effectively, with a minimum amount of downtime in a challenging, fast-paced environment. We are looking for reliable, hard-working team members - if this is you, apply with us today Major Duties and Responsibilities: Will manage daily maintenance needs and routine preventive maintenance work to ensure the proper upkeep of the machinery, equipment, fixtures and the facility. These responsibilities may also include, but are not limited to: General facility maintenance, assembly and maintenance on fixtures, office equipment and furniture repair. Maintain and repair a variety of kitchen equipment including kettles, skillets, ovens, warmers, thermal units, racking, conveyor and heat seal machines. This may require reading service manuals, schematics, diagrams, blue prints or as-builds. Ability to read schematics, diagrams, service manuals and blue prints. Goal-driven with the ability to multi-task and work a flexible schedule, covering varied shifts. Troubleshoots maintains and repairs machinery and equipment within the designated facility. This may include, but is not limited to, conveyors, PLC, packaging equipment, minor electrical, hydraulics, pneumatic, instrumentation, refrigeration, water, sewer, treatment, etc. This may require reading service manuals, schematics, diagrams, blue prints or as-builds. Assemble, maintain and repair office area and repair office area including lighting, bathroom plumbing, paint, trim and furniture. Clean, patch and paint as needed. May complete landscaping tasks, as needed. Assists with maintaining and sourcing tools, parts and supplies. Required to adjust devices and control instrumentation. Routinely uses excepted practices to troubleshoot equipment and machinery. Manage preventative maintenance (PM) agreements with vendors and ensure PM visits occur in a timely fashion for equipment such as HVAC, refrigeration, forklift, compressor and generator. Perform regular (daily/weekly/monthly/annual) property and equipment inspections. Controls and tracks downtime associated with maintenance and repair work. Documents what corrective actions were taken. Respond to emergency calls during non-business hours. May coordinate with agency representatives to inspect and ensure that all required certifications are up-to-date (sprinkler systems, health department, fire marshal, etc.). May need to liaise with 3rd party vendors at the site or by phone where equipment is under warranty, or to help establish or diagnose a problem. Maintains the highest level of professionalism and demeanor as a business representative. Coordinate service calls with trades people when necessary. Ensure that all maintenance tools are in good working condition and stored neatly and securely. Maintain tool inventory. May assist with sourcing tools, parts and supplies. Perform other tasks as needed (including lifting 50 pounds, cleaning units, maintain and secure tools, etc.) Follows all required safe work practices. This includes lockout tag-out requirements and wearing of all required PPE in designated areas, confined space safety, safe chemical handling, fall restraints, etc. May assist team members with related tasks when needed. Performs other duties, as needed. Preferred Qualifications: 3+ years experience in a similar Maintenance Technician position performing mechanical, pneumatic, hydraulic, minor electrical, plumbing, and carpentry-related tasks. A solid mechanical background is required. Apprenticeship, related training, and/or education is helpful. Experience working in a fresh or chilled food environment that supports the ability to work in an independent capacity. Experience working with tile and masonry repair helpful. Basic computer literacy and the ability to update facility maintenance systems. Food Handler certification. Knowledge of common food handling safety requirements Required Knowledge, Skills, and Ability: Must have a good mechanical aptitude and ability to read schematics, diagrams, service manuals and blueprints. Goal-driven with the ability to multi-task and work a flexible schedule, covering varied shifts. Ability to routinely work in a chilled, damp factory environment. Ability to diagnose and repair faulty equipment and problem-solve, while working under pressure and compressed timelines Ability to use a variety of hand and power tools, meters, and material handling equipment in performing duties A strong electro-mechanical background is preferred. Knowledge of common food handling safety requirements is preferred. Good problem-solving skills and able to thrive in a very fast-paced, demanding environment. Able to work well with others and participate as part of a team using good verbal communication skills.
